Description
CSF1, also known as macrophage colony-stimulating factor 1, is a hematopoietic growth factor that is the primary regulator of the survival, proliferation, differentiation and function of mononuclear phagocytes. It is a four alpha-helical bundle cytokine and its active form is found extracellularly as a disulfide linked homodimer. This protein plays important roles in innate immunity, cancer and inflammatory diseases, including systemic lupus erythematosus, arthritis, atherosclerosis and obesity. In several conditions, activation of macrophages involves a CSF1 autocrine loop. In addition, secreted and cell-surface isoforms of CSF1 can have differential effects in inflammation and immunity.
